site stats

React router navigate with state

WebRouters define a component's navigation state, and they allow the developer to define paths and actions that can be handled. Built-In Routers react-navigation ships with a few … WebReact-Router的安装方法: npm: $ npm install react-router-dom@6. yarn$ yarn add react-router-dom@6. 目前官方从5开始已经放弃原有的react-router库,统一命名为react-router …

Redirect in React Router V6 with useNavigate hook refine

WebIf you are using React Router 6, the proper way to navigate programmatically is as follows: import { useNavigate } from "react-router-dom"; function HomeButton () { const navigate … Web我一直在嘗試各種方法來顯示來自React模板中流星提取的數據。 我不完全理解為什么這么難做到。 當我在模板中使用getMeteorData時,使用 this.data.user. id 時不會顯示數據 使用componentDidMount 。 我已按照流星網站上的react meteor教程學習, ... [ Router.State, Router.Navigation ... earth dominating architecture https://delenahome.com

Feature Overview v6.10.0 React Router

If you need state, use navigate (to, { state }). You can think of the first arg to navigate as your and the other arg as the replace and state props. To access the route state in the consuming component use the useLocation React hook: const { state } = useLocation (); Share Improve this answer Follow edited Oct 25, 2024 at 20:40 WebAdding a Router First thing to do is create a Browser Router and configure our first route. This will enable client side routing for our web app. The main.jsx file is the entry point. … WebApr 9, 2024 · Here's the code on my other page: export default HomePage (props) { const {state} = useLocation (); useEffect ( ()=> { // here consolo.log says state: null console.log ( … ctfo inc

Client-side routing in React with React Location - LogRocket Blog

Category:Programmatically navigate using React router - Stack …

Tags:React router navigate with state

React router navigate with state

How to pass state or data in react-router v6 - Medium

WebHaving a component-based version of the useNavigate hook makes it easier to use this feature in a React.Component subclass where hooks are not able to be used. import * as … WebThe navigate function has two signatures: Either pass a To value (same type as ) with an optional second { replace, state } arg or; Pass the delta you want to go in the …

React router navigate with state

Did you know?

WebDec 23, 2024 · we want to navigate our users to /dashboardafter they successfully log in. This is exactly the place where we would want to navigate programmatically. React Router provides us useNavigateand to do exactly that. Let us see how we can use them: WebFeb 2, 2024 · Creating React application and installing module: Step 1: To start with, create a React application using the following command: npx create-react-app ; Step 2: Install the latest version of react-router-dom in the React application by the following. npm install react-router-dom

WebMar 17, 2024 · Connected React Router is a Redux binding for React Router v4 and v5. It synchronizes router state with Redux store via a unidirectional flow and uses react-hot … WebThe path to navigate to. navigate("/some/where") If using props.navigate in a Route Component, this can be a relative path. props.navigate("../") You can pass a number to go …

WebMar 17, 2024 · With react-router, you pass state or data from one component to another component to use the react-router Link component. Data pass more quickly in the new … Web, Router } from "react-router-dom"; export interface BrowserRouterProps extends Omit { history: History; } export const BrowserRouter: React.FC = React.memo(props => { const { history, ... restProps } = props; const [state, setState] = React.useState({ action: history.action, location: history.location, }); React.useLayoutEffect(() => …

WebApr 9, 2024 · import { useLocation } from "react-router-dom"; import { useEffect } from "react"; export default function () { const location = useLocation (); const bill = location.state.bill; console.log (bill); useEffect ( () => { const billDiv = document.getElementById ("bill"); if (billDiv) { billDiv.innerHTML = bill; } }, [bill]); return ( ); } …

Webreact-navigation Routing and navigation for your React Native apps GitHub MIT Latest version published 2 years ago Package Health Score 64 / 100 Full package analysis Similar packages earth donut theoryWeb1 day ago · I have been on this for quite some time now, and I can't seem to figure out why react useNavigate isn't working as expected. It's not working as it is taking me to 'currentPage1' instead of redirecting to '/'. This is my router config: } /> earth donut shapeWebSep 29, 2024 · If you choose to pass the path you want to navigate and the second optional argument, then you can do it like so: import { useNavigate } from "react-router-dom"; const navigate = useNavigate(); const submitHandler = async (event) => { event.preventDefault(); try { await submitForm(); navigate("/success"); // Omit optional second argument ct fondoWeb目前,react-router-dom@5和React 18之间存在不兼容问题。 ... 还要注意的是,Link是一个React组件,因此它必须作为React组件返回的一部分被渲染到DOM中,而navigate函数是一个函数,可以在回调中使用。 ... (to, { replace, state, target, }); return ... ct folk fest 2022WebReact Router enables "client side routing". In traditional websites, the browser requests a document from a web server, downloads and evaluates CSS and JavaScript assets, and … earth donationWebApr 5, 2024 · React 17.0.2 React router 6.2.1 typescript 4.2.3 text You can use hooks to pass state to the transition destination. At v5 useHistory is used to implement the flash … earth donutWebSep 10, 2024 · But, easy peasy. There are two ways to programmatically navigate with React Router - and navigate (). You can get access to Navigate by importing it from … earth doodle vector